A court in Ghaziabad has stayed the construction of a metro tower on a piece of land belonging to a builder in the Vaishali area.
After the stay ordered over the weekend, Ghaziabad Development Authority vice-chairman Narender Chaudhry said construction on the land owned by N. K. Rajput was started without verifying the ownership.
Mr. Rajput told reporters that it was a temporary hurdle and the court would be approached for an early disposal of the matter.
